“Never again”

Fort Garry Hotel

14 May 2008
1/1 found this review helpful

I stayed at this hotel as part of a polar bear travel package. Stayed there the first and last night of the package and thought is was really pretty bad. The lobby and banquet rooms are very nice. The rooms are in need of some serious updating. Plumbing is old. The worse part was that there is no thermostat in the rooms. I could not sleep because the room was so hot and the windows are sealed shut. I would never stay at the FG again!

“Best Bet in Winnipeg”

Fort Garry Hotel

10 May 2008
2/2 found this review helpful

I have stayed at the Fort Garry several times in the past as well as other hotels in Winnipeg and I've decided that the Fort Garry is my best option while visiting Winnipeg. On this particular trip, our stay at the Fort Garry was very nice and we were very pleased with the cleanliness of the room as well as the service. Front desk staff were friendly and attentive, providing me with all of the information I needed. The valet was very helpful, providing parking tips and even opened my door for me. We took advantage of the free coffee and tea room service as soon as we settled into our room and it was such a nice touch as they even provided fresh baked cookies on the tray. Our room was very quiet and the beds were very comfortable. I slept very well, and that is uncommon for me while sleeping over in a hotel. The next morning we were treated to a very nice free (tip is extra) breakfast that included fresh fruit, assortment of breads, pastries and cheese, cereals, oatmeal, yogurt, omelettes made to order and carving station with baked ham as well as very good coffee and fresh squeezed orange juice. With the free breakfast, I believe that the Fort Garry is a great, reliable place to stay in Winnipeg and turns out to be a good value when compared to the other options available in the downtown area.

“Interior needs Updating!”

Fort Garry Hotel

8 Mar 2008
1/1 found this review helpful

I was so looking forwarded to staying at the FG, as I have always admired the exterior architecture and assumed that the interior of the Hotel would be as magnificent. The foyer remains grand, but as we exited the elevator and headed to our room my stomach dropped. The hallway and "executive" suite was reminiscent of the hotel in the movie "The Shining."

The executive suite, was in fact, 2 rooms that were put together. 1 Room was a sitting room with furniture that resembled a grandmothers garage sale and smelled damp. The bedroom' s furniture was also outdated, but the bed and linens were updated and very comfortable - which saved our 1 night stay. The bathroom had old white tile, old vanity, but the water pressure was good and the toiletries were great (L'Occitane).

Also, the television was reminiscent of the 80's and was fuzzy. It appears that the private owner of the hotel is waiting for a buyer and only updating what is absolutely necessary.

I immediately phoned the front desk to ask if there were rooms available that were updated. She notified me that there were ONLY 2 rooms that had been rennovated w/hardwood, sunk in tub, etc and they were booked. So, if you want to stay at the FG and have a luxurious experience - be sure to specify that you want an updated room or 1 of the 2 updated rooms/Junior Suite. I have a feeling they reserve these rooms for Brides/people who have their weddings at the hotel.

HOWEVER, the SPA is absolutely AMAZING. I am assuming a separate company runs that part of the hotel. It is so worth going to the FG, but maybe stay in a different hotel.

“What an amazing hotel! It's a castle!”

Fort Garry Hotel

26 Feb 2008
1/1 found this review helpful

Hotel Fort Gary is an amazing historic hotel in downtown Winnipeg. It really is a castle, dating back from the 1900s, when the city was just being built.
The lobby was full of people, live piano music and a foyer lounge called 'The Palm Room'. It feels like a 1920 piano bar (because it is!). The food is fantastic and the service is fast and professional.
Since the hotel is a British design from 1900, the rooms are not big, but they are very nice and clean. The most comfortable beds in the world are features of this hotel. Believe me!
This hotel seems to be a hot spot among locals and many locals were in the lounge and the restaurants. This is always a good sign! Breakfast is a great feature at this hotel. Hot full breakfast, made to order! Nice!
Sundays, the hotel does a wonderful Sunday Brunch from 10a to 2p, which is full of locals. Another good sign.
The hotel doesn't have a pool/hot tub/work out centre IN the building (due to the age of the hotel), however, your room key card gives you free 24h access to those things at Fort Gary Place, the condo tower which is connected to the hotel via sky walk, so it is great.
The hotel is located in south downtown, which is mostly condo towers and resturants. The downtown shopping malls are a bit of a walk, howwbeit in the summer, the 10mins is not bad at all.
Also, just down the street (west) is Osborne Village, and very trendy section of downtown! Full of shops, pubs, eateries and a supermarket.
Public transit is easy to use from this hotel, and the train station is a few blocks away.
We LOVE this hotel!

“Lovely hotel”

Fort Garry Hotel

Save Review
4 of 5 stars
Grand Rapids, MI
5 Feb 2008
1/1 found this review helpful

Enjoyed our stay here. Spent three nites. Two nites on the front end of our Churchill Polar Bear Trip and one nite at the end. The hotel is lovely and historic. Enjoyed having a drink in the lobby bar. We walked across the street for dinner two nites to "The Keg" Steakhouse. Great food! Had a banquet meal at the hotel one nite when we met our tour group. It was okay. The hotels breakfast is wonderful. They have made to order omelets that were excellent. The hotel rooms were a bit tired...since we had two stays here we had two different rooms. Very similar. The carpet could have been a bit cleaner. Maybe it was just worn and faded. The bed linens and mattresses were so comfortable that we slept like babies. The hotel seems like a hot spot for locals too.
